Beetroot care guide

Beetroot (Beta vulgaris subsp. vulgaris (root)) is a foliage plant that likes very bright light or direct sun and water every 5 days. Here is everything you need to keep it healthy.

How often to water Beetroot

Water Beetroot every 5 days as a baseline. Treat that as a reminder to check rather than a rule to follow blindly — push a finger an inch or two into the soil and water only if it feels dry at that depth.

Expect to water more often in warm, bright, or dry conditions, and noticeably less in winter when growth slows. A pot with drainage holes matters more than the exact interval: standing water is the most common way houseplants are lost.

Light requirements

Beetroot prefers very bright light or direct sun. It needs as much light as you can give it, including several hours of direct sun. A south-facing windowsill or a sunny patio is ideal.

If growth becomes stretched and leggy with long gaps between leaves, it is reaching for more light. Pale or bleached patches usually mean the opposite — too much direct sun.

Feeding and fertilizer

Feed Beetroot about once a month through the growing season using a balanced liquid fertilizer at half the strength on the label. Pause over winter — an unfed plant recovers far more easily than one with fertilizer burn.

Care notes

Both roots and leaves are edible. Keep soil consistently moist and thin seedlings for best root development.
